    What Is Ceramic Water Filtration?

    At its core, ceramic water filtration is a mechanical process. Imagine a very fine, porous clay pot—often made from diatomaceous earth—that water is forced through. The tiny, microscopic pores in the ceramic material are small enough to trap physical contaminants like dirt, rust, sand, and even bacteria and protozoan cysts like Giardia and Cryptosporidium.

    But that’s only half the story. Most modern ceramic filters aren’t just clay. They’re composite, typically featuring a ceramic outer shell and a solid carbon filter cartridge on the inside. This combination gives you the best of both worlds: physical filtration from the ceramic and chemical adsorption from the carbon. The carbon tackles dissolved contaminants like chlorine, volatile organic compounds (VOCs), and improves taste and odor.

    It’s a technology that’s been used in everything from household units to emergency relief efforts for decades. It’s not flashy, but it’s remarkably effective when designed correctly.

    How Ceramic Filtration Works

    The Ceramic Pore Structure

    The magic is in the micron rating. A human hair is about 70 microns wide. Most quality ceramic filters have an absolute pore rating of 0.2 to 0.5 microns. That’s incredibly small. Bacteria like E. coli are typically 0.5 to 2 microns, so they get physically blocked. Water molecules, being much smaller, pass through. This is a physical, size-exclusion method—nothing gets through that’s larger than the pores.

    The Activated Carbon Core

    Once the water passes through the ceramic shell, it usually flows through a central core of activated carbon. This is similar to what you’d find in a standalone carbon water filtration system. The carbon has a massive internal surface area (a teaspoon can have the surface area of a football field) that adsorbs chemical contaminants through a process called adsorption. Chlorine molecules, for example, stick to the carbon like a magnet.

    Gravity or Pressure?

    How the water moves through the filter matters. Many ceramic systems are gravity-fed—think of a Berkey-style countertop unit. You pour water in the top, and gravity slowly pulls it through the filters into the lower chamber. No plumbing, no electricity. Other systems are designed for under-sink use and work with your home’s water pressure, pushing water through the ceramic element. The flow rate is generally slower than a standard carbon water filter, which is the trade-off for such fine filtration.

    Key Benefits of Ceramic Filters

    Effective Bacteria Removal: This is the big one. A properly rated ceramic filter is certified to remove >99.99% of bacteria and >99.9% of protozoan cysts. If you’re on well water or have boil-water advisories, this is a major safety feature. It’s a physical barrier you can trust.

    Long Filter Life & Low Cost: Ceramic elements can be cleaned. When the flow rate slows (usually due to surface clogging), you can gently scrub the outside with a soft brush under running water. This restores flow and extends the filter’s life significantly—often to 6-12 months or thousands of liters. Replacement costs are typically low.

    No Power, No Waste: Gravity-fed models require zero electricity and produce zero wastewater. That makes them perfect for camping, emergencies, or reducing your environmental footprint. They just sit on your counter and work.

    Retains Healthy Minerals: Unlike reverse osmosis, ceramic filtration doesn’t strip beneficial minerals like calcium and magnesium from your water. It removes the bad stuff, leaving the good.

    A Honest Drawback: Don’t expect a ceramic filter to remove everything. They are not effective against dissolved salts, heavy metals like lead (unless the carbon core is specially treated), fluoride, or most viruses on their own. For heavy metals, you need a dedicated carbon filtration block or a different technology. Always check the specific manufacturer’s performance data sheets.

    Types of Ceramic Filtration Systems

    Countertop Gravity-Fed Systems

    The most popular type. Two stacked chambers, with one or more ceramic “candle” filters screwed into the upper chamber. You fill the top, water filters down. Simple, portable, and effective. The classic example is the British Berkefeld/Doulton system. This is where you’ll often see the term ceramic candle filter used.

    Under-Sink Direct Flow Systems

    These connect to your cold water line and dispense from a dedicated faucet. They use a solid ceramic cartridge, often combined with other filter stages. They offer the convenience of filtered water on tap but require installation. Flow rates can be a bit slower than your main tap.

    Faucet-Mounted & Pitcher Filters

    Some faucet mounts and even a few pitcher filters use small ceramic elements. They’re convenient for renters or low-volume use, but the filter capacity and flow rate are usually much lower than dedicated countertop or under-sink units. The ceramic in these is often a secondary stage.

    Ceramic Filter Buying Guide

    Not all ceramic filters are created equal. Here’s what I look at:

    1. Micron Rating: Look for an “absolute” micron rating, not “nominal.” Absolute means 99.9% of particles larger than that size are trapped. 0.2 microns is excellent for bacteria. 0.5 microns is still very good.

    2. Certifications: This is non-negotiable. Look for independent testing to NSF/ANSI standards. NSF/ANSI 42 covers aesthetic effects (taste, chlorine). NSF/ANSI 53 is for health effects—this is the one that certifies cyst reduction. If a brand doesn’t publish these test results, walk away.

    3. Filter Composition: Is it just ceramic, or ceramic with a carbon core? For most municipal water, you want the carbon core to handle chlorine and VOCs. Some premium filters add silver or other materials to inhibit bacterial growth within the filter itself.

    4. Capacity & Flow Rate: How many liters will it filter before needing replacement or cleaning? What’s the flow rate in liters per hour? Gravity systems are slow; know what you’re getting into.

    5. Build Quality & Materials: Check what the housing is made of. Is it BPA-free plastic? Stainless steel? How do the seals look? A cheap filter housing can leak and ruin your day.

    Ceramic Filtration FAQ

    Do ceramic water filters remove viruses?
    Most standard ceramic filters do not remove viruses, as viruses are much smaller (often 0.02-0.3 microns) than the filter’s pores. Some advanced systems incorporate a whole house carbon filtration stage or other technology to address this. Always check the manufacturer’s test data for virus reduction claims.
    How do I clean a ceramic filter candle?
    Gently scrub the outer surface under cool running water with a soft-bristle brush (a new toothbrush works). Never use soap or detergents. This removes the layer of trapped sediment and restores the flow rate. Don’t scrub too aggressively, as you’ll wear down the ceramic.
    Can I use a ceramic filter with well water?
    Yes, they are excellent for well water because they effectively remove sediment and bacteria. However, you must first test your well water. If it has high levels of nitrates, heavy metals, or agricultural chemicals, you’ll need additional filtration stages beyond just ceramic and carbon.
    Why is my ceramic filter so slow?
    Slowness is normal; it’s a fine filter. But if it’s slower than usual, it’s clogged. Time to clean it. Cold water also filters slower than room-temperature water. If cleaning doesn’t help, the filter may be nearing the end of its life and needs replacement.
    Are ceramic filters better than carbon filters?
    They’re different. A ceramic filter is a physical barrier that excels at removing bacteria and sediment. A carbon filter is a chemical adsorber that excels at removing chlorine, tastes, and odors. The best systems combine both, using the ceramic as the first line of defense and the carbon as the polishing stage.
